Anzac Day

It is Anzac a national day of remembrance in Australia and New Zealand, the day honours members of the New Zealand and Austrailian Army Corps(ANZAC). Initially the day commemorates both corps endeavors at Gallipoli in Turkey during World War 1. The first memorial was held 96 years ago. Now Anzac day is more broadly commemorates all those who died and served in military operations for their countries.

Over the past several years there has been a resurgence in attendance at Anzac services across New Zealand.
